Watermelon Arugula and Feta Salad

Description
Watermelon Arugula and Feta Salad blends chilled, seedless watermelon cubes with fresh arugula leaves and crumbled feta cheese. The addition of very thinly sliced red onion introduces a subtle pungency, which complements the sweetness of the watermelon. A simple vinaigrette of balsamic vinegar, extra virgin olive oil, kosher salt, and black pepper ties the ingredients together with a tangy finish. The salad is assembled by washing and drying the arugula, whisking the dressing, and tossing all elements lightly before serving. This combination provides a crisp, juicy texture balanced with creamy and slightly salty feta. It can serve as a light appetizer or a refreshing accompaniment to grilled proteins or warm-weather meals.
Ingredients
- 3 cups watermelon cubed and chilled, seedless
- 1/2 cup feta cheese crumbled
- 7 oz arugula
- 1/4 red onion sliced very thin, small
- 2 tbsp balsamic vinegar
- 2 tbsp extra virgin olive oil
- kosher salt
- black pepper
Instructions
- Wash arugula and dry well.
- In a large bowl whisk vinegar, olive oil, salt and pepper.
- Toss with the remaining ingredients and serve.
